Skip to main content

CS - REVISION : NUMBER SYSTEM / BOOLEAN ALGEBRA - 10/12/24


REVISION

NUMBER SYSTEM CONVERSION

1.    Convert the Decimal number(125)10 into its binary equivalent.

2.    Convert (95)10 =( )2

3.    Convert Decimal fraction into binary fraction : (105.15)10

4.    Convert (0.14)10  to binary.

5.    Convert Decimal to Octal :

i) (125)10

ii)(0.21875)10

6.    Convert the decimal (300)10 into its Hexadecimal.

7.    Convert (0.03125)10 into hexadecimal fraction.

8.    Convert (0.675)10 into hexadecimal form.

9.    Convert (2C9)16 into decimal.

10. Convert (423)10 into hexadecimal.

11.  Do the following conversion:

i.(ABCD)16 to ( ?)2

ii.(3567)10 to (? )8

12. Write Binary equivalent of the following octal numbers.

i.2306    ii.743     iii.65.203

13. Write Binary representation of the following hexadecimal:

i. 4026     ii.BCA1     iii.132.45

 

BOOLEAN ALGEBRA 

1.What is Unicode? What are its advantages?

2. What is Truth Table?

3. What are Logic Gates?

4. What do you mean by duality principle?

5. Explain de-Morgan's Law with example.

6. What are Boolean operator. Explain AND ,OR and NOT.

7. Draw logic circuit for the Boolean expression:(x'+y') z+w'



Comments

Popular posts from this blog

CS - SORTING/SEARCHING ALGORITHMS

  SORTING ALGORITHMS                       SORTING ALGORITHM PDF LINK #Bubble Sort          ·        The outer loop iterates through the entire array. ·        The inner loop compares adjacent elements and swaps them if they are out of order. ·        The outer loop runs n times, and each pass moves the largest element to its correct position. arr=[3,8,5,2,1] n = len(arr) print(n) for i in range(n):  #traverse through all the elements         # Last i elements are already sorted, no need to check them         for j in range(0, n-i-1):              # Swap if the element found is greater than the next element              if arr[j] > arr[j+1]:               ...

GRADE XI - NESTED FOR LOOP

                                                         NESTED FOR LOOP 1. for var1 in range(3):      print(var1,"OUTER LOOP")          # 0 outer loop       1 outer loop      2 outer loop          for var2 in range(2):                  print(var2+1,"INNER LOOP")    #1  2 inner loop     1  2  inner loop   1 2 inner loop  2. Print the following pattern using for loop: 1  1 2  1 2 3  1 2 3 4  Sol: for r in range(1,5):   #ROWS     for c in range(1,r+1):   #COLUMNS         print(c,end=" ")     print() 3. Print the following pattern using for loop: @  @ @  @ @ @...

LIST IN PYTHON - 14TH AUG

  LIST IN PYTHON BEGINNERS PRACTICE QUESTIONS 1. Creating List by accepting data from user List1=[] #Empty list n=int(input("Enter number of elements"))    i=0 while i < n:     num= int(input("Enter element " + str(i) + ": "))     List1+=[num]       i+=1 print(List1) OR #Creating List by accepting data from user List1=[ ] n=int(input("Enter number of elements"))   i=0 while i < n:     List1+=[int(input("Enter the element"))]       i+=1     print(List1) 2.Write a program to input the size and the list of elements from user. Count the number of elements  which are divisible by 5 list1= [ ] s =int (input("Enter no of elements")) for i in range(s):     list1 += [int (input("Enter the Elements"))] count=0 for num in list1:         if num % 5 ==0:             count = count+1 print("No. of elements divisible by 5--",c...